        Oh, so you must have been opposed to the removal of Saddam, since  
anyone with even a bit of knowledge of the region knew that only his  
ruthlessness was able to hold together that unstable mix of divergent  
interests. All military assessments before the invasion agreed that  
it would take a very strong military presence to maintain the order  
that Saddam was able to keep.

        The reason that Iraq is such a mess now is that the Bush  
Administration did not heed the advice of its own military experts  
and instead followed the PNAC vision of an American-controlled state  
in the ME automatically bringing stability to an unstable region. And  
now we are supposed to continue to follow the advice of the people  
who got us into this completely avoidable mess and trust them to get  
us out. Sorry, this isn't baseball; you don't get three strikes.
